Abstract
METODO PARA MEJORAR LA EXTENSION RADIAL Y OTRAS PROPIEDADES DE UN INJERTO VASCULAR TUBULAR REFORZADO CON CINTA FORMADO POR FLUOROPOLIMEROS SINTETIZADOS, COMO PTFE SINTETIZADO EXPANDIDO. EN TERMINOS GENERALES, EL COMPRENDE EL PASO DE CONTRAER RADIALMENTE LA CAPA DE LA CINTA DE REFUERZO DEL INJERTO, OLA TOTALIDAD DEL INJERTO REFORZADO CON CINTA, DESPUES DE LA SINTESIS. ESTA CONTRACCION RADIAL DE LA CAPA DE LA CINTA DE REFUERZO, O DE TODO EL INJERTO, HACE QUE EL INJERTO SE EXPANDA POSTERIORMENTE EN SENTIDO RADIAL MAS DEL 5 %, SIN DESGARROS O ROTURAS DE LA CAPA DE LA CINTA DE REFUERZO DEL INJERTO. LOS INJERTOS EXTENSIBLES RADIALMENTE DE LA PRESENTE INVENCION PUEDEN COMBINARSE CON DISTINTOS TIPOS DE STENTS O SISTEMAS DE ANCLAJE PARA FORMAR DISPOSITIVOS DE INJERTO ENDOVASCULAR QUE PUEDEN INSERTARSE POR VIA TRANSLUMINAL E IMPLANTARSE EN LA LUZ DE UN VASO SANGUINEO DEL HUESPED. COMO ALTERNATIVA, LOS INJERTOS EXTENSIBLES RADIALMENTE DE LA PRESENTE INVENCION PUEDEN IMPLANTARSE MEDIANTE TECNICAS TRADICIONALES DE IMPLANTACION DE INJERTOS QUIRURGICOS, SIN EXTENSION RADIAL DEL INJERTO EN EL MOMENTO DE LA IMPLANTACION, PARA BENEFICIARSE DE LAS PROPIEDADES MEJORADAS DE RESISTENCIA Y DE SOPORTE DE SUTURA DE LOS INJERTOS CONTRAIDOS RADIALMENTE REFORZADOS CON CINTA DE LA PRESENTE INVENCION.
